In foundries, efficient sand management is vital for maintaining casting quality, productivity, and cost efficiency. One of the most effective strategies is the integration of sand coolers with return sand handling systems. This approach ensures that used sand from molding processes is not only cooled but also conditioned for immediate reuse. By combining cooling, moisture adjustment, and handling in a single streamlined process, foundries can reduce downtime, enhance consistency, and minimize waste while keeping production cycles smooth and reliable.

The integration process focuses on synchronizing cooling systems with conveyors, elevators, and mixing units to create a seamless return sand loop. Sand coolers reduce the temperature of hot return sand while restoring optimal moisture levels, preventing issues such as bridging, lumps, or inconsistent mold hardness. When connected directly with return sand handling systems, the process eliminates manual intervention and ensures that sand flows evenly back into the molding line. This level of automation improves energy efficiency, throughput, and casting performance.

Advanced foundries also benefit from real-time monitoring, automated controls, and predictive maintenance when integrating sand coolers into return sand systems. These features enable operators to detect temperature variations, moisture imbalances, or blockages instantly and take corrective action before problems escalate. By adopting an integrated approach, foundries achieve higher-quality molds, reduced rejection rates, and longer equipment life.
